Parsley (Petroselinum crispum) is a popular, nutrient-rich Mediterranean herb used fresh or dried to flavor dishes, garnish food, and freshen breath, prized for its vitamins (A, C, K) and antioxidants, with flat-leaf (Italian) and curly-leaf types common in cooking, while roots can be eaten too, all offering culinary and potential health benefits like improved digestion and detox support.
